First thing mention is that he criticize the concept that itis front page news that the Stock Market went up 3 points, it is non-news that people are having a hard time surviving.
He then mention Abortion,
Then he mention people in the church who wants to turn the church back to 1940 and rejects that idea on the grounds the Church's first concern should be the poor not personal salvation.
He mentions what he refers to a Gnostic influences within the church, something he opposes.
Then he says the poor are the Gospel and to help the poor is to do Christ's work.
The next paragraph is as follows (Computer translation):
(to reflect you how hard to take care of the Roman Curia, and the commission of cardinals who will support, etc..) And, yes ... it's hard. curia In some people holy, really, people holy. But there is also a stream of corruption , there also is true ... It speaks of the "gay lobby", and it is true, is there ... you have to see what we can do ...
The Pope makes a request that people pray for him, that he be wrong as little as possible
The Pope then spoke of a meeting her had, it was a good meeting, but something was to come out of it, but did not and thus taken as a whole did not do what he wanted out of the meeting.
He then mentions to many groups holding onto old buildings and money, he sees that as a problem, to many people within the church are more concerned about money then they vocation and that problem has to be addressed.
